QUOTE(Arevind7 @ Nov 11 2017, 10:12 AM) Thank you bro. Are you aware of how long we can delay our service after 6 months before they say warranty void or too late? Cos I’m planning to send it in 2 weeks. As far as I know, they allow up to 1 month or 1,000km overdue.It’s really up to the service manager’s perogative, but so far from what I heard, it’s the above. Best to send it in before it’s due rather than overdue. |
